  1. CGDB: Circadian Gene DataBase
  2. This is a circadian gene database.
    1. The database includes circadian gene DNA and protein sequences, model organisms specific to each circadian gene, clear descriptions of the circadian gene functions, and circadian gene tags specific to this database and other databases (http://cgdb.biocuckoo.org/view.php?id=021036).
    2. Circadian Gene DataBase is a secondary source of data.
  3. The Cuckoo Workgroup Maintains the database.
